Ticket PICKOPT-812: Config drift on prod optimizer

The PickRoute optimizer in the Vastermill warehouse is using different batching thresholds than staging. Likely a hotfix was applied directly to prod last month and never backported. Pick-list sizes now diverge between sites, causing support tickets. Do not hand-edit further. Prod's current values, captured today, are below.

settings of bawif-fawif:
ralix:
  log_level: warn
  metrics_host: metrics.ralix.tolvaqsys.internal
  pool_size: 32

The tile-rendering cache sits between the renderer pool and the edge nodes, and it must be deployed before the renderers or cold-start traffic will overwhelm them. Deploy one cache instance per region, pointing each at its regional object store, and confirm the warm-up job completes before flipping traffic. Eviction is size-based with a TTL backstop; do not disable the backstop, as stale tiles caused the Renholm outage last spring. The configuration values a fresh instance should start with are listed below.

service settings:
novath:
  pin: 1396
  tenant: pelys
  seal: seal_ccc035e1
  metrics_host: metrics.novath.qorvelworks.test
  standby_team: fraeth
  escalation: drueth-zorok
  nonce: 61d508

**Step 4: Retry semantics for Hookline v3**

Quick heads-up for the sync: the new delivery engine in Hookline retries webhooks with exponential backoff instead of the old fixed 30-second loop. Failed deliveries now get five attempts over roughly ten minutes, then land in the dead-letter queue for manual replay. If your consumer can't handle duplicates, add idempotency keys now — seriously, before Thursday. Deliveries marked 410 are dropped immediately, no retries. The current defaults for the staging cluster are as follows.

config for hahip-kageg:
[aldael]
port = 11211
region = outer-4
host = aldael.zarqelsys.example
team = casion
timeout_ms = 250
retries = 6

Expansion is a three-phase process: announce the new shard ring, dual-write during the rebalance window, then cut reads over once lag drops under one second. Plugins must never cache shard assignments across the rebalance window; always resolve through the router. Before writing any code against a newly expanded cluster, verify your client matches the router's active settings, listed below.

settings of yadug-tawig:
[julath]
port = 8443
team = oliax
host = julath.ferraio.internal
region = lower-3
access_code = ac_30fca8
timeout_ms = 1000